Re-soak every 3 months or so. To keep salt and spices from getting clumped with moisture, as well as crackers and chips crispy, dry Brown Sugar Bear in the oven, cool, and place in a sealed container with the food you want to keep dry.

How do you clean a sugar Bear?

To clean the Brown Sugar Bear and other softening products, simply boil them in hot water and pat dry with a paper towel or clean cloth. The Potwatcher can be cleaned in the dishwasher because it is non-porous. Do not use soap to clean the softening products so as to avoid unwanted residue left behind.

How long does it take Brown Sugar Bear to work?

The moisture within the clay will slowly release over 2 to 3 months at a consistent rate. The clay bear supplies moisture indefinitely to brown sugar. It can be soaked in clean water over and over again for repeated use. 2How long do you soak the Brown Sugar Bear?

Why is my brown sugar moving?

Brown sugar is made by coating white sugar with molasses. When brown sugar is soft, it is because the molasses is fresh and damp, allowing the sugar crystals to easily move against one another. When brown sugar is exposed to air, the moisture of the brown sugar evaporates as the molasses begins to dry out.

Does brown sugar get bugs?

Like all sugars, the sugary deliciousness of brown sugar can attract ants and other bugs. If you see any signs of bug life, alive or dead, you should dispose of and replace your brown sugar. The second instance is mold. Although rare, brown sugar can grow mold if left in a humid environment for a long period of time.
